Output 62b03e3b3c83044f560efb0dca34328c2e5c746f211f7dc586f84c3d330e9436:4

value
12200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8692c1be1377f8815f51088f18dd5e690bf9a53d OP_EQUAL
address
3DxaH6DR2REErAdkowQyegoKGeF3Y8uFc1
transaction
62b03e3b3c83044f560efb0dca34328c2e5c746f211f7dc586f84c3d330e9436
spent
true